We are still seeing mandatory, binding arbitration clauses being put in admission forms for Alabama nursing home residents. In my opinion, this is impossible to justify and will result in poor care and treatment for persons who have to be placed in a nursing home in Alabama.
It’s difficult to understand how a nursing home boss can force arbitration on residents of their facility and get away with it. No segment of our population is more vulnerable. It’s my judgment that these folks deserve to be protected from the evils of arbitration and to receive the very best in medical care and treatment.
